“Nice business hotel in great location”
4 of 5 stars Reviewed December 4, 2012

Great hotel directly across from faneuil hall. Plenty of shopping and eating establishments very close by and three T stops very nearby as well for easy public transit. The hotel was spacious and nicely redone with plenty of room to move around in the main living area and a nice large bathroom/dressing area. Only downside was the shuttle back to the airport the hotel provided for my husband. They didn't call him a taxi, put him on the shuttle that only took cash and told him it was $25 plus tip, and assured him it was the same rate as a public taxi. The public taxi that I took however was about half that price, I paid $16 total from the same location. Be weary on that. Other than that, the hotel was wonderful and we had a great stay!

Room Tip: higher floors have less noise, and we had a nice room with a small balcony that looked over Faneuil...

“Excellent location, comfortable rooms”
5 of 5 stars Reviewed December 3, 2012

As many past reviewers have noted, this location can't be beat. It's right across from Faneuil Hall and Quincy Market, close to the North End (Italian section - lots of great restaurants). Also not far from T stops. This place was recommended to us by a native Bostonian who stays there every time he visits his family.

Upon arrival, our room was upgraded. Room was spacious, had a fireplace and balcony. I think that would be a Superior Room. Our particular room was oddly shaped, and the TV was a little far from the bed, and at an angle that made it difficult to see from the bed, so we had to move it a bit.

Bed was comfortable, bathroom was large with separate stall shower and tub. There was a hair dryer and robes.

In the early evenings there was hot cider in the lobby (guessing that is seasonal). Very tasty.

The only down side is that the rooms are not very sound-proof. We specifically requested a quiet room, which was noted by reception at check-in, and they told us they gave us a room that faced the interior for quiet. However, it still faced Quincy Market. At night, there were drummers playing at the Market, and the sound echoed throughout the area. Even with the A/C running, and a white noise machine we brought with us, you could still hear the drumming. And the traffic. It might not be the quietest location.

Room includes wi-fi internet.

“Great Hotel & Great location”
5 of 5 stars Reviewed November 27, 2012

This hotel is perfectly located in Boston for all tourist activities. We recently had a weeks stay and thoroughly enjoyed. Our room over looked Faneuil Hall and Quincey Market (beautiful view of all the lighting trees and Christmas Trees at this time of year) it was of a generous size in comparison to most city hotels. Room was spotless and had daily cleaning service. amenities included mini bar, huge flat screen tv, very comfortable armchair, dressing room and decent hairdryer. We requested feather free bedding prior to our arrival and was all organised as requested. The staff were very pleasant and very helpful. Breakfast was of a very high quality and provided a great choice.

Room Tip: Rooms over looking Faneuil hall have a lovely view especially this time of year
